a specific understanding of

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"a specific understanding of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ing a detailed or precise comprehension of a particular subject or concept. Example: "In order to excel in this field, one must have a specific understanding of the underlying principles."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"a specific understanding of", ensure the subject of understanding is clearly defined to avoid ambiguity. For instance, instead of "a specific understanding", specify "a specific understanding of quantum physics".

Common error

Avoid using "a specific understanding of" when a general understanding is sufficient. Saying "a specific understanding of the topic" when any basic knowledge will do dilutes the phrase's impact and can sound pretentious.

FAQs

How can I use "a specific understanding of" in a sentence?

Use "a specific understanding of" to indicate detailed comprehension of a particular subject. For example, "The project requires "a specific understanding of the market"".

What's the difference between "a specific understanding of" and "a general understanding of"?

"A specific understanding of" implies detailed and precise knowledge, while "a general understanding of" suggests basic familiarity. For example, having "a general understanding of history" differs greatly from having "a specific understanding of the causes of World War I".

Which is better, "a specific understanding of" or "a deep understanding of"?

Both are valid, but "a specific understanding of" emphasizes precision and focus, whereas "a deep understanding of" emphasizes thoroughness and insight. Choose based on the context; use "specific" when precision matters most and "deep" when insight is key.

What can I say instead of "a specific understanding of"?

You can use alternatives like "a detailed comprehension of", "a precise grasp of", or "a clear perception of" depending on the nuance you want to convey.
